Herbert Smith Freehills

Herbert Smith Freehills has been a loyal community partner of Able Australia for many years, dedicating much needed pro bono legal support, financial assistance and volunteer support on a number of key projects.

For many years, Herbert Smith Freehills has been the major sponsor of the Able Art, our annual art exhibition as well as supporting the wider Australia art therapy program. Art Therapy is one of our most sought after therapy services by the people we support.
